Understanding SOCKS5 Proxy and Its Benefits for Enterprises

SOCKS5 is an internet protocol that facilitates the transmission of data packets through a proxy server. Unlike HTTP proxies, SOCKS5 operates at a lower level, making it versatile for a wide range of protocols such as FTP, SMTP, and even peer-to-peer services. This flexibility allows enterprises to use SOCKS5 proxies for various purposes, from securing communication to optimizing internet access in different regions.

For enterprises, SOCKS5 proxies offer numerous advantages:

1. Enhanced Privacy and Security: SOCKS5 proxies provide an additional layer of security by masking the IP address, making it harder for external parties to track users' online activities. This is especially crucial when dealing with sensitive business data or when operating in regions with strict data protection laws.

2. Improved Network Performance: SOCKS5 proxies can help in load balancing, reducing latency, and improving overall network performance. By routing traffic through optimized paths, businesses can enhance the speed and reliability of their internet connections.

3. Bypass Geographical Restrictions: Many businesses face the challenge of accessing region-specific content, especially when expanding operations globally. SOCKS5 proxies can route traffic through servers in different locations, bypassing geographical restrictions and enabling access to region-locked services.

Implementing PY SOCKS5 Proxy for Global Traffic Routing

Using PY SOCKS5 proxies for global traffic routing is an effective way for enterprises to manage their internet traffic efficiently. The implementation process involves configuring the proxy server to route requests from different geographical regions to the desired destination. Here’s how enterprises can use PY SOCKS5 proxies to manage global traffic:

1. Global Server Network Setup: Enterprises need to set up proxy servers in various regions around the world. This can be done through cloud services or dedicated servers located in key geographical areas. These servers will act as intermediaries, routing traffic through optimal paths based on regional needs.

2. Traffic Routing Configuration: Once the proxy servers are set up, the next step is to configure the routing rules. This can involve specifying the destination regions for different types of traffic, ensuring that each request is routed through the best available proxy server based on the user’s location or the application’s requirements.

3. Load Balancing and Failover: To ensure uninterrupted service, enterprises can implement load balancing and failover mechanisms. This means distributing traffic evenly across different proxy servers, reducing the load on any single server and ensuring that traffic is rerouted automatically if one of the servers fails.

4. Testing Network Performance: Enterprises can use PY SOCKS5 proxies to test network performance in different regions. By routing traffic through various proxy servers, they can measure latency, bandwidth, and connection stability, providing valuable insights into the performance of their network infrastructure.

Using PY SOCKS5 Proxy for Testing Regional Network Performance

Testing the performance of regional networks is essential for enterprises that want to optimize their services for global customers. PY SOCKS5 proxies offer a practical solution for testing network performance across different regions. By simulating user traffic from various geographical locations, businesses can gain insights into the real-world performance of their services.

1. Latency and Speed Testing: With PY SOCKS5 proxies, businesses can test the latency and speed of their connections from different regions. This helps in identifying potential bottlenecks and optimizing routing paths to improve user experience.

2. Accessing Region-Specific Services: Some services or content are restricted to specific regions. By using SOCKS5 proxies, enterprises can simulate access from different locations and test how their services perform in different markets. This is particularly useful for businesses expanding globally and needing to adapt to local regulations or preferences.

3. Simulating User Behavior: Enterprises can simulate user behavior by routing traffic through proxies in various regions. This allows them to see how their websites or applications perform under different network conditions, helping them optimize their infrastructure to handle global traffic more efficiently.

Advantages of PY SOCKS5 Proxy for Enterprise Security and Privacy

In addition to its role in traffic routing and performance testing, PY SOCKS5 proxy also provides significant security and privacy benefits for enterprises. Here's how businesses can enhance their security posture with SOCKS5 proxies:

1. Data Encryption: SOCKS5 proxies do not encrypt traffic by default, but they can work with encrypted protocols such as HTTPS or VPNs. By using SOCKS5 in conjunction with these protocols, enterprises can ensure that their communications are secure from interception or eavesdropping.

2. IP Address Masking: By using SOCKS5 proxies, enterprises can mask their IP addresses, making it difficult for malicious actors to trace their online activities. This is important for businesses concerned about cyberattacks or protecting sensitive information.

3. Anonymity for Sensitive Operations: For enterprises involved in sensitive operations, such as financial transactions or confidential communications, SOCKS5 proxies provide a level of anonymity that enhances the security of these operations.

Challenges and Considerations for Enterprises Using PY SOCKS5 Proxy

While PY SOCKS5 proxies offer numerous advantages, enterprises should also be aware of potential challenges:

1. Proxy Configuration Complexity: Setting up and configuring PY SOCKS5 proxies can be complex, especially for businesses with limited technical expertise. It’s essential to have a knowledgeable IT team or seek professional help to ensure optimal proxy setup.

2. Performance Variability: Although SOCKS5 proxies can improve performance, the actual results depend on the quality of the proxy servers and the network conditions. Enterprises should regularly monitor their proxy infrastructure to ensure it’s meeting performance expectations.

3. Legal and Compliance Issues: Depending on the regions in which an enterprise operates, there may be legal and compliance issues related to the use of proxies. Businesses should ensure that their proxy usage complies with local laws and regulations, especially concerning data privacy.
